Jennifer Lopez felt compelled to play domestic violence victim in 'Unstoppable': 'We had similar struggles'
Briefly

"When I read the script, I felt like so many women including myself could relate to the struggles that she had gone through in her life. The story, being a Latino story, being so inspiring. It was something that kind of grabbed me. And I was, like, OK, this is really really interesting."
"Just talking to her I realized we're almost the same person in a weird way even though we're so different and had such different lives - that at the core, in the heart of who we were, first we were moms. And beyond that we had similar struggles."
